Issues
- 3
Integration of Ruff in Codacy
#13391 opened by valeriupredoi - 3
previous import affects # noqa: I001 directive
#13404 opened by AntiSol - 3
SLF001 when using Django Model `_meta` API
#13382 opened by bittner - 0
Slicing string around `len()` (expansion of FURB188 slice-to-remove-prefix-or-suffix)
#13396 opened by opk12 - 2
PLE1205 false-positive with Loguru
#13390 opened by dorschw - 4
DOC501 doesn't trigger if a custom exception imported from another module is raised
#13383 opened by taranlu-houzz - 3
- 1
ruff 0.6.5 occasionally panics when used as LSP inside Emacs
#13392 opened by offby1 - 1
Support [lint.isort] group_by_package config
#13389 opened by an0o0nym - 3
- 6
PLE2510, PLE2512, PLE2513, PLE2514, and PLE2515 fixes add escape sequences to raw strings
#13294 opened by dscorbett - 2
When set to parents (default) ban-relative-imports setting results in no errors despite parent relative imports being present
#13378 opened by lgig - 0
Trailing parenthesized function return type comment becomes leading comment
#13369 opened by MichaReiser - 1
Option to disable awkward line breaks for assert statements
#13386 opened by 0xjmux - 4
Ruff 2025 style guide
#13371 opened by MichaReiser - 2
`FURB180` should consider allowlisting some classes
#13307 opened by robsdedude - 3
duplicate return statements after pre-commit run
#13310 opened by mpurusottamc - 4
False positive F821 for a variable initialised on the first line of %%timeit (Jupyter notebook)
#13374 opened by vitawasalreadytaken - 1
Docs: Rules table icon column and icons are inaccessible
#13376 opened by MHLut - 1
FURB188 ignores the slice’s step
#13349 opened by dscorbett - 2
E731 Doesn't Ignore Dataclass Attributes
#13336 opened by max-muoto - 0
(opened with wrong account, please ignore)
#13377 opened by glukai - 2
G002 gives a false positive with translated strings
#13350 opened by jpmckinney - 4
Doctest dynamic line width is off if examples are indented
#13358 opened by tugrulates - 1
Formatter: allow spaces in keyword arguments
#13344 opened by nbraud - 4
- 3
DTZ007 - arguably a false positive
#13359 opened by rbubley - 1
- 2
Invalid fix for PLE1141
#13343 opened by martinlehoux - 3
F821 on EncodingWarning on gated code
#13296 opened by jaraco - 0
Explore using a token tree
#13356 opened by MichaReiser - 4
Feature: Check for unintended non-printing characters
#13297 opened by jaraco - 7
I001: `zoneinfo` not recognized as a stdlib package for PEP-8 compliant import formatting.
#13354 opened by gtkacz - 2
Bug: False format for list slicing with self.x as index
#13351 opened by CareF - 2
- 3
Task Tag Blocks
#13340 opened by scarere - 2
Detecting possible NameError: name 'var' is not defined
#13347 opened by ashrub-holvi - 2
Add a rule-specific equivalent of the `--ignore-noqa` flag
#13341 opened by Zac-HD - 2
Allow character ranges or locales in `allowed-confusables` for RUF001, RUF002, & RUF003
#13330 opened by namurphy - 1
RUF001 gives a false-positive with an emoji
#13337 opened by RubenVanEldik - 11
- 2
Formatter: Different behavior of `line-length` between ruff and black for docstrings and comments
#13339 opened by kevalmorabia97 - 7
pep8-naming N rules fail to find misnamed variables in generator/list comprehensions
#13325 opened by ember91 - 3
- 2
flake8 flag F811 when ruff not flag it
#13324 opened by lrandrianasoloarinavalona - 2
- 4
- 1
Converting `__file__` to a named path variable triggers E402
#13303 opened by ncoghlan - 1
Syntax error in formatter known deviation docs
#13312 opened by ulope - 4
[internal] `ComparableExpr` docstring does not match behavior
#13291 opened by dylwil3